版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、1 NETFLOW支持设备:Cisco 800, 1700, 2600 Yes Cisco 1800, 2800, 3800 Yes Cisco 4500 Yes Cisco 6500 Yes Cisco7200, 7300, 7500 Yes Cisco 7600 Yes Cisco 10000, 12000, CRS-1 Yes Cisco 2900, 3500, 3660, 3750 Nonetflow是ios平台技术,也就是说路由器全系列都支持,而交换机平台则依赖于IOS版本和支持硬件,例如 Cisco 2900, 3500, 3660, 3750就不支持我们关注交换网络核心设备:65
2、00/7600 系列:1 启动netflowSwitch(config)# mls netflow2 启动netflow 的双向流量Switch(config)# mls flow ip destination-source 后面可接其他参数3、进入VLAN,启动接口Netflow(如果在物理接口上其3层,则直接进入物理接口)Switch(config)# interface vlan 5Switch(config-if)# ip flow-export ingress-此处为ingress 可以配置engress 依赖ios版本Switch(config-if)# ip route-cach
3、e flow4 配置Netflow的数据源,如果没有配置Loopback的接口,可以采用物理接口,建议配置Loopback接口Switch(config)# ip flow-export source loopback 05 配置统计信息的输出目的,即采集服务器的ip和监听端口(config)#ip flow-export 10.1.200.201 99917. 配置输出版本,目前可支持版本1和5(config)#ip flow-export version 5下面为参考命令:Switch# show mls nde一般看到都是Netflow Data Export disabled 这说明N
4、etflow都没有起来。参看Cisco Configuring NetFlow Data Export PDf文档,默认是Disabled的启动NDE发送以及发送版本Switch(config)# mls nde sender version 5 | 7 如果只输入mls nde sender 系统默认启用的是版本7,如果需要版本5,则mls nde sender version 5 ,目前版本能配的是5或7,这两个版本WEB均能出现正常的数据。对于Cisco IOS 12.17以下版本的交换机,只有版本7。参考部分用户反映netflow网管机器,没有收到数据包,可参考上面命令酌情配置,未必有
5、效4500 系列:1 配置Netflow的数据源,如果没有配置Loopback的接口,可以采用物理接口,建议配置Loopback接口Switch(config)# ip flow-export source loopback 02 配置统计信息的输出目的,即采集服务器的ip和监听端口(config)#ip flow-export 10.1.200.201 99913. 配置输出版本,目前可支持版本1和5(config)#ip flow-export version 54. 设置路由器中flow cache的过期时限,建议按照以下配置:活动连接的时限为1分钟(即活动的连接每隔1分钟发送该连接的数
6、据流量统计信息),非活动连接的时限为10秒钟。(config)#ip flow-cache time active 1(config)#ip flow-cache time inactive 10(config)#ip flow-cache active-timeout 305部分Cisco4500就不支持,也就是它不能在某个Interface配置打开Netflow,要么所有端口启用,要么都不启用,重要的无法区分不同Interface上的流量情况,只能看到整个设备所有的流量情况,只能在全局模式下开启:Switch(config)# ip flow ingress infer-fields如果可
7、以在接口上使用:那么进入VLAN,启动接口Netflow(如果在物理接口上其3层,则直接进入物理接口)Switch(config)# interface vlan 5Switch(config-if)# ip route-cache flow下面cisco官方说明:-Note Enabling NetFlow on a per interface basis is not supported on a Catalyst 4500 switch. -This example shows how to enable NetFlow globally: Switch# configure termi
8、nalSwitch(config)# ip flow ingressThis example shows how to enable NetFlow with support for inferred fields: Switch# configure terminalSwitch(config)# ip flow ingress infer-fields netflow 总结1:Netflow released Version:(Netflow based UDP) V9:和V8/5/1不兼容,最大的Feature就是template,具有extensible:但是也因为V9是基于templ
9、ate,需要传输额外的模版数据,默认为20:1,占总流量的4%,Device为了维护Template必须消耗更多的资源 V8:只能针对aggregate cache:当你再路由器上开启route-based netflow aggregation,就可以使用V8 V5:只能针对Main cache:(比较常用):后续增加了BGP AS信息和 流序列号信息 V1:最先的发行版本,不再使用: V2/V3/V4:没有released V6:not support很多国际标准多是基于Netflow的:(IETF) IP Information Export (IPFIX) Working Group
10、(WG) and the IETF Pack Sampling (PSAMP) WG are based on the NetFlow Version 9 export format.2:配置Netflow的前提: 启用路由功能 开启CEF/DCEF/Fast switch三者选一 确认Device resource,Netflow需要resume additional resource3:针对Netflow capture traffic:=Ingress NetflowIP to IPIP to MPLSFR terminateATM terminate=Engress NetflowIP
11、 TO IPMPLS TO IP(MPLS 倒数第二跳)4:netflow confirm flow with 7 keywords:S/D IP ; S/D Port ;3层protocol type ;TOS;ingress interface2 在部署netflow,通常需要考虑部署位置,在早期IOS版本中,只支持ingress方向数据流统计,对出方向engress不做统计,例如:假设 一个路由器有两个接口 A和B,由于缺省情况下,Netflow数据统计只针对进入(ingress)数据进行,当你只启用接口A的NetFlow数据输出时,它只能输出接口A的流入(IN)流量和接口B的流出(OU
12、T)流量。接口A的流出流量只能由接口B的NetFlow输出数据才能得到。所以如果不启用接口B的数据输出,将得不到接口A的流出流量信息。 用cisco官方图片实例:图我们看到图中,箭头方向就是数据流动方向,server则是我们部署netflow网管机位置,那么,在那些接口需要开启netflow呢:从图中,我们可以看到:在图中用椭圆形标注的地方就是需要开启netflow的接口,从数据流向分析+标注位置,我们发现全是数据流的入接口方向开启。 如果是版本支持方向部署,那么部署位置,则简化许多: 图2如上面图2所示。与图做比较,发现部署位置,只需要对相应设备做配置即可,不再依赖于接口。如何判断是否支持出
13、方向技术,最简单的方法。能否在接口或者全局模式开启:Switch(config-if)# ip flow-export engress-或者 switch(config-if)# ip flow engress2 谈到 netflow 的排错 使用netflow技术,出现问题,一般集中在netflow 分析仪,没有数据那么对应我们排错,应该思路应该是: 先检查物理设备上面命令是否开启,开启参数是否正确 确认netflow设备工作正常,检查netflow分析仪,对应接收参数是否有误。 确认上面2步无误情况,检查netflow分析设备和netflow物理设备是否有防火墙,或者其他物理隔绝,阻隔UD
14、P数据包 检查是否是netflow设备开启端口位置不对等等下面给出对应简单排错方法: 1 需要检查对应平台配置命令,例如对于4500 和6500 平台配置命令,就有所不同,需要查看对应命令,查看配置是否有误。A 命令show ip flow interface检查接口上面上是否开启netflowRouter# show ip flow interface Ethernet0/0 ip flow ingressB 命令 show run 看是否设定输出端口,及ip地址等, 2 确认配置上面没有问题,我们则应该使用IOS相关检测命令,看是否有netflow的输出,和1中提到命令配合: 常用的是 s
15、how ip cache flow show ip flow export 下面给出netflow配置输出检测方法:1 使用Cisco-4507R#show ip flow export 会出现类似于下面输出;Flow export v5 is enabled for main cache Exporting flows to 192.168.1.1 (9995) Exporting using source interface Loopback0 Version 5 flow records 40 flows exported in 3 udp datagrams 0 flows failed due to lack of export packet 0 export packets were sent up to process level可间隔10S或者更长时间,重复使用上述命令。看红
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2025年度篮球运动员个人荣誉奖励合同3篇
- 公益性岗位劳动合同协议书(2025年度)-社区健康促进3篇
- 2025年度新能源汽车合伙人股权分配与产业链整合合同3篇
- 2025年度农村宅基地房屋租赁与乡村旅游资源开发合同2篇
- 2025年农村自建房安全责任追究协议书
- 二零二五年度智能机器人研发项目采购合同风险管理与防范3篇
- 2025年度智能制造企业监事聘用合同规范文本3篇
- 二零二五石材品牌授权与市场营销合作合同3篇
- 二零二五年度日本语言学校入学合同2篇
- 二零二五年度公司与公司签订的智慧社区建设合作协议3篇
- 【浅析人工智能在石油行业中的应用3400字(论文)】
- 湖北省十堰市竹山县2023-2024学年三上数学期末经典模拟试题含答案
- 产品试制前准备状态检查报告
- (全)外研版丨九年级下册英语各模块作文范文(名校版)
- 煤矿企业瓦斯防治能力评估管理办法和基本标准
- 食品供应质量承诺书
- 驾驶员从业资格证电子版
- vas疼痛评分完整版
- 山东省临沂市兰山中学2022-2023学年高二化学上学期期末试题含解析
- 信息与计算科学专业课程标准
- 袁莎入门古筝教材1
评论
0/150
提交评论